APAR status
Closed as program error.
Error description
During order process, you encounter a NullPointerException similar to the following message: [4/19/18 17:28:12:715 CEST] 00000241 CommerceSrvr E com.ibm.commerce.command.ECCommandTarget executeCommand CMN0420E: The following command exception has occurred during processing: "java.lang.NullPointerException". java.lang.NullPointerException at java.util.Hashtable.put(Hashtable.java:580) at com.ibm.commerce.order.commands.GetOrderPaymentInfoCmdImpl.perfo rmExecute(GetOrderPaymentInfoCmdImpl.java:102) .... .... when either the name or value of the ORDPAYINFO record is null.
Local fix
Problem summary
USERS AFFECTED: WebSphere Commerce Version 8 and Version 9 PROBLEM ABSTRACT: GetOrderPaymentInfoCmdImpl throws NullPointerException BUSINESS IMPACT: Order submit fails when empty values are provided for payment attributes. RECOMMENDATION:
Problem conclusion
Updated logic to check for empty values before putting them into a hash table.
Temporary fix
Comments
APAR Information
APAR number
JR59470
Reported component name
WC BUS EDITION
Reported component ID
5724I3800
Reported release
800
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2018-04-24
Closed date
2018-06-12
Last modified date
2018-06-12
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
WC BUS EDITION
Fixed component ID
5724I3800
Applicable component levels
R800 PSY
UP
[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SYSYL","label":"WebSphere Commerce Enterprise"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"8.0","Line of Business":{"code":"LOB31","label":"WCE Watson Marketing and Commerce"}}]
Document Information
Modified date:
11 December 2021